1. What is ethics in research?
The word “ethics” is Greek for “ethikos.” It refers to „the rule of conduct recognized in certain
associations or departments of human life‟ (Simpson, 2004). Nursing Research uses human beings as
subjects, the researcher must exercise caution to protect the rights of the subjects against undue
impositions.
2. What are the basis for ethical standards in Nursing Research? Basis for Ethical Standards
A. Nuremberg Code
B. Declaration of Helsinki
C. CIOMS
D. Belmont Report
